I know the Zukauskas’ correlation for bare tubes bundles, but I’m now looking for a correlation valid for forced convection across finned tubes bundles (staggered and in-line arrangement).

Refer "Fundamentals of Heat Exchanger Design" by R K Shah & D P Sekulic. I have found this book very useful, especially for extended surface coolers.
 
Ione,

You might also check with Finned Tube Tech in the Tulas area. They used to have the complete Escoa Design Manual available for download. No longer online. However, I think you might need to talk with someone there to get a copy. It's an excellent resource.
